Wire thread inserts are critical components in various engineering and manufacturing applications. They provide a reliable means of reinforcing threaded holes, especially in materials prone to wear and tear. Used widely in the automotive and aerospace industries, these inserts help maintain strong connections. They offer enhanced durability and resistance to stripping, making them indispensable in high-stress environments.
Applications of wire thread inserts extend beyond heavy machinery. They find use in consumer electronics, furniture, and even home improvement projects. The versatility of these inserts enables seamless integration into diverse materials, like metal and plastic. However, selecting the right insert can be challenging. Often, users struggle with choosing the correct size and thread type. This can lead to installation errors that compromise performance. Careful consideration is essential when evaluating application requirements.
When exploring wire thread inserts, several key features are essential for quality and performance. First, consider material durability. Inserts made from high-strength stainless steel or titanium offer exceptional resistance to wear. Reports indicate that materials like stainless steel can withstand temperatures up to 1500°F. This ensures longevity even in demanding applications.
Thread design is another vital aspect. Inserts should have deep grooves for better anchoring and stability. A study found that inserts with optimized thread profiles reduce installation torque by 30%. This simplifies the installation process and lowers the risk of stripping threads, which can be costly.
Surface finishing also plays a crucial role. A smooth surface reduces friction, enhancing insertion ease. However, not all smooth finishes guarantee quality. It's important to verify the finish against industry standards. Some inserts may lack proper quality control, leading to premature failure. Inconsistencies in sizing can also create fitting issues, impacting the overall project. By focusing on these characteristics, buyers can make informed decisions when selecting wire thread inserts.

Wire thread inserts serve a crucial role in various industries. They enhance the durability of threads and improve fastening applications. Various types of wire thread inserts exist, each with distinct benefits and drawbacks. For instance, some are designed for high-temperature environments, while others aim to resist corrosion.
Comparing these options reveals the importance of material choice. Stainless steel inserts offer great strength but may be pricier. Brass inserts, on the other hand, are cost-effective but lack the same durability. The right selection depends on the specific application and environment.
